(a)
(1)For purposes of this section, “employee” means any person employed by the Department of Corrections and Rehabilitation.
(2)For purposes of this section, “retaliation” means intentionally engaging in acts of reprisal, retaliation, threats, coercion, or similar acts against another employee who has done any of the following:
(A)Has disclosed or is disclosing to any employee at a supervisory or managerial level, what the employee, in good faith, believes to be improper governmental activities.
(B)Has cooperated or is cooperating with any investigation of improper governmental activities.
(C)Has refused to obey an illegal order or directive.
